Make-Ahead, Storing and Reheating

As much as I love the fresh-out-the-oven taste of these Cherry Almond Mini Scones as soon as they’re out, I understand the need for convenience. After all, life can be hectic sometimes! That’s why I’m giving you some tips on how to make-ahead, store and reheat these scones.

To make-ahead, prepare and cut the dough as instructed in the recipe. Then, place them in a freezer-safe container lined with parchment paper and store them in the freezer for up to 1 month. When you’re ready to bake them, simply put them in the oven from the freezer and add an extra 2-3 minutes to the bake time. Voila!

To store already-baked scones, keep them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days or in the fridge for up to 5 days. If you want to extend their shelf life even further, store them in the freezer for up to 1 month. To reheat already-baked scones, warm them up in preheated oven (350°F) for about 5-7 minutes or until heated through.

If you wish to maintain that fresh-out-the-oven taste, I suggest reheating only the amount of scones that you will eat immediately while keeping the rest stored away.

Tips for Perfect Results

 Enjoy with your favorite warm beverage for the ultimate cozy treat.
Enjoy with your favorite warm beverage for the ultimate cozy treat.

To make sure your cherry almond mini scones turn out perfectly every time, here are some tips that I find helpful.

Firstly, be sure to use very cold margarine or coconut oil when cutting it into the dry ingredients. This is important because it creates pockets of fat in the dough that will result in a tender and flaky texture once baked.

Secondly, do not overmix the dough. As soon as you add the liquid to the dry ingredients, just mix until the dough barely comes together. Overworking the dough will result in tough and dense scones, rather than light and airy ones.

Thirdly, make sure to measure your flour properly. Too much flour will lead to dry, crumbly scones, while too little flour will cause them to spread out into flat discs. I recommend using a kitchen scale to measure your flour accurately.

Fourthly, if you want to add chocolate chips or dried fruit to your scones, toss them with a little bit of flour before folding them into the dough. This will help prevent them from sinking to the bottom during baking.

Lastly, don’t skip the step where you brush the tops of the scones with a mixture of soymilk and maple syrup. This adds a lovely shine and sweetness to your cherry almond mini scones while also creating a beautiful golden brown crust on top.

By following these simple tips, you’ll be able to bake up a batch of delicious and perfectly textured cherry almond mini scones every time!

Cherry Almond Mini Scones (Vegan)

Cherry Almond Mini Scones (Vegan) Recipe

These are some super yummy scones! My husband adores these and I almost regret getting him hooked because they are so tempting to me as well! Work quickly with the dough and try not to over work it so your scones stay light. This recipe comes from The Vegan Lunchbox. (You can also add chopped almonds to the mix if you have some on hand - yum!!)
No ratings yet
Prep Time 10 mins
Cook Time 18 mins
Cuisine Vegan
Servings 12 mini scones
Calories 201.9 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up whole wheat pastry flour
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on sea salt
  • 1/4 cup nonhydrogenated margarine, cold
  • 1/2 cup soymilk (almond milk works as well)
  • 3/4 cup cherries, fresh or frozen, thawed, drained and chopped
  • 1 teaspoon almond extract

Instructions
 

  • Preheat the oven to 400ºF.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and spray with nonstick spray. Set aside.
  • Sift together the flours,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Add the margarine and cut into the flour mixture using a pastry cutter or your fingers, until the mixture resembles a coarse, crumbly meal.
  • Add the soymilk, cherries, and almond extract. Mix well with a wooden spoon or your hands until the mixture comes together to form a dough. You may need to add an extra tablespoon of soymilk if the mixture is too dry.
  • Turn the dough out onto a lightly floured work surface. Divide the dough in half and form each half into a flat round, about 3/4 inch thick. Cut each round into six equal wedges.
  • Arrange the scones on the baking sheet. Brush the tops with a bit of soymilk and sprinkle with sugar. Bake for 15 to 18 minutes, until the edges and bottom are golden. Serve warm or cover with dish towel until ready to serve.
